Location and Area

Located just half a mile from the charming village of Tintagel, renowned for its rich historical legends centered around King Arthur and the Knights of the Round Table, Trenale Court is nestled in the tranquil rural hamlet of Trenale, approximately one mile from the dramatic cliffs along the North Cornwall Coast. This complex comprises eight thoughtfully converted stone cottages arranged around a beautifully landscaped courtyard. Each cottage boasts its own enclosed small garden, and there’s an added bonus of a shared recreational paddock, perfect for exercising dogs while revelling in panoramic sea vistas and breath-taking sunsets.

Situated on one side of a peaceful country lane, these holiday cottages provide an ideal launching pad for exploring Cornwall, whether on foot or by car. An array of scenic walks lies within close proximity, including the enchanting coastal footpath and the stunning Rocky Valley. Tintagel, with its array of shops, pubs, and restaurants, can be reached in less than a 5-minute drive or a pleasant stroll and is home to the renowned medieval castle and Merlin’s sea cave.

The charming National Trust harbour at Boscastle is just 2.5 miles away, and a leisure centre with a swimming pool awaits in Camelford, 4.5 miles distant. Bossiney Cove, a leisurely 20-minute walk away, reveals a sandy beach at low tide, while the surfing haven of Trebarwith Strand is a mere 10-minute drive.

Each of the eight cottages possesses its own unique character, yet they share many similar features. This makes them a favoured choice for families and friends looking to vacation together while still enjoying the comforts of individual accommodations.

Accommodation

Boasting delightful sea vistas from its garden, this former granary has undergone a transformation into a generously proportioned split-level family cottage, nestled discreetly to one side of the entrance to Trenale Court.

An added convenience lies in the provision of two parking spaces conveniently situated adjacent to the property within the corner of the well-tended courtyard. The front door, accessed via a single step, welcomes you into a practical entrance porch. Beyond the fully glazed inner door lies a charming dining room adorned with exposed beams, artfully separated by open studwork from a fitted kitchen. The kitchen is equipped with modern conveniences, including a dishwasher, fridge/freezer, electric hob, oven, and microwave. Rounding off the ground floor amenities is a bathroom featuring a WC, hand basin, a shower over the bath, and a heated towel rail.

A brief ascent up a carpeted staircase leads to a half landing where three bedrooms await, each offering different sleeping arrangements: a double bed, zip-link twin beds, and 3ft pine bunk beds. Further stairs ascend to a gallery-style sitting room, characterized by its television, exposed beams reaching up to the apex of the roof, and some tastefully exposed stonework. Comfortable seating is thoughtfully arranged before an electric fire. In one corner of the lounge, three slate steps gracefully descend to French windows that open onto a grassy enclosed garden, affording captivating views over the surrounding farmland to the sea. A gate in the garden provides access to the pathway leading to the shared recreational paddock.

The property is efficiently heated through electric heating. Shared amenities include a laundry room furnished with a washing machine and tumble dryer for added convenience.
